SENIOR CLASS HISTORY On a Monday morning of September 1933 a group of fifteen girls and eleven boys entered Leaf River High School 0 further their educa- tion. We met with our sponsor, Kiss Miner, that day to elect our o3nss officers. We elected the following; Martha Albert----------------president Phyllis Haire----------Vice President Betty Peterson--------- -So.c.r t.ary Maxine Whitney---------------Treasurer Lois Lovell------Student Couneil Rep. The Freshman Initiation was held in Octo- ber. We all dreaded this, but it wasn't as bad as we were told it was going to be. During our freshman year we lost two girls, Margaret Stahl and Vella Knodle, and one boy Delmar Cook. In September 1934 our enrollment was in- creased by Eileen Cuplin. Fj»r our officers we elected the following: Maxine Whitney---------------President Lois Lovell-------Vice President Emerson Baker----------------Secretary Orville Borneman-------------Treasurer Myra Schelling--Student Council Rep. Miss Miner was again our class sponsor. We lost two more of our boys in our sophomore year, Arthur Blake and Henry Thomas. In September 1935 we chose our class of f icers ; Maxine Whitney---------------President Everett Ashton--------------------Vice President Lois Lovell------------------Secretary Orville Borneman-------------Treasurer Emerson Baker---Student Council Rep. Mr. Wunderlick was chosen as our sponsor. Our Junior class play was held in May; the title was Chintz Cottage. Our Junior-Senior banquet was held at Schrom's banquet room in Rockford where an interasting program was held

Page 16 text:

And now as Seniors of 1937 we are about to complete our High School education. Cur en- rollment was increased by Dorothy Carpenter and Lucille Wells,making a total of twenty members. Our class offi®ers are: Emerson Baker-----------------President Dorothy Carpenter--------Vice President Lois Lovell-------------------Secretary Lois Wilson-------------------Treasurer Everett Ashton----Student Council Rep. Maxine Whitney----Student Council Rep. Mr. Hanson is our sponsor. 'Ve are all proud that we are to graduate from Leaf River Com- munity High School May 28, 1937. STATISTICS OF THE' CLASS OF 1937 Some fascinating facts concerning our class are herein inscribed in the 1937 edition of the Ebb. This information was obtained by vote of the student body for the various titles mention- ed . The Best Looking boy is Everett Ashton; and The Best Looking Girl is Maxine Whitney; the Most Dignified boy is Orville Borneman; and the Most Dignified girl is Martha Albert; The Most Popular boy is Everett Ashton; and The Most Popular girl is Maxine Whitney; the Kindest boy is William Schroder; and The Kindest girl is Lois Wilson; The Most Valuable boy and girl is John Rowland and Maxine Whitney; The Most Stu- dious boy is Wi 11 iam Schroder ; and The Most Stu- dious girl is MyraSche1ling; The Most Talented boy is Orville Borneman; and The Most Talented girl is Maxine Whitney; The Best Dressed girl is Phyllis Kaire; The Neatest Person is Martha Albert; The boy with The Most Pep is Everett Ashton; and the girl with the Most Pep isMaxine Whitney; The Most Amusing Person is Dorothy Carpenter; The Most Promise of Success is Myra Schelling; The Eest Leaders are Emerson Baker and Maxine Whitney; The Most Bashful boy is Floyd Hachmeister; and The Most Bashful girl is Ethel Gann; The Class Dreamer is Ethel Gann.
